Q: Is 33,968 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 33,968 is not a prime number.

Why is 33,968 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 33968 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 11 16 22 44 88 176 193 386 772 1,544 2,123 3,088 4,246 8,492 16,984 and 33,968, with no remainder.

Since 33,968 cannot be divided by just 1 and 33,968, it is not a prime number.
